Insight: Brotherhood – Oyster RHD Guard Sprocket

September 2, 2015

A few months back we were tipped off about a brand from Russia called “Brotherhood” that was producing a few different BMX sprockets and small parts. The reason we were so interested is because of a two-piece sprocket they had developed called the Oyster which is similar to an actual oyster was hollow and has two parts that come together to make a solid piece. The other day we received a package in the mail and would you know, there was an Oyster ready for us to get a closer look at. Curious what this thing is all about and how it works? Insight: Proper Bike Co. – Select Hub Guards

August 20, 2015

proper-bmx-select-hub-guards

With the ever growing popularity of grinding and finding a way to grind smoother, further and all around better, we’ve seen a lot of innovation from pegs to hub guards over the years. We’ve gone from heavy oversized pegs to titanium, aluminum and plastic pegs and we have seen hub guards in multiple variations as well from guards you zip tie on to designs that snap into place or slide on replacing the existing hardware. However, there’s still room for some innovation. The guys over at Proper Bike Co. have been busy working on their new range of products that have just recently been released worldwide through BMX shops and mail-orders. One of the items in particular we thought was pretty interesting are their new Select hub guards that use a slightly different design than other options on the market.
